Output 22098647d8c1d66bdba66792a05d7101ebcc2e7f3b592d4e5b1dfe2fcf4bbe0a:10

value
816446
script pubkey
OP_0 OP_PUSHBYTES_20 d66cb8caba88a37277b14cb954a720faafa8bcb1
address
bc1q6ekt3j463z3hyaa3fju4ffeql2h63093h8uqp0
transaction
22098647d8c1d66bdba66792a05d7101ebcc2e7f3b592d4e5b1dfe2fcf4bbe0a
spent
true